What is Mouth Cancer, and where can it occur Mouth cancer, also called oral cancer, is when abnormal cells start growing uncontrollably somewhere inside your mouth. It’s not just one place—it can show up in a bunch of areas. Like on the lips, the tongue, inside the cheeks, or even on the roof of the mouth or the floor of the mouth, just under the tongue. It doesn’t always start out looking dangerous. Sometimes it just looks like a small sore or patch that doesn't go away. That’s why it often gets missed early on. What causes Mouth Cancer or raises the risk There are a bunch of reasons someone might get mouth cancer, and it’s not always just bad luck. A lot of risk comes from lifestyle. Tobacco use is the number one risk—cigarettes, cigars, chewing tobacco, even betel nut. It irritates the mouth and causes precancerous Mouth Cancer spots to form, which can turn into tumors later. Heavy alcohol drinking also raises the risk. When someone drinks and smokes together, the risk gets way worse. Then there’s HPV, a virus that’s often passed through oral sex. It’s now known to cause some types of early stage mouth cancer, especially in younger people. Too much sun exposure to the lips without protection can lead to lip cancer, and bad oral hygiene or rough dental work can irritate the mouth lining. Voice changes, like hoarseness that won’t go away Persistent bad breath, even after brushing A feeling like something’s stuck in the throat Numbness in the tongue or cheek Pain on one side, like discomfort in the left jaw or neck If you’re wondering about the difference between mouth ulcer and cancer, here’s the deal—an ulcer usually heals in 1-2 weeks. It may hurt, but it fades. Cancer doesn't go away and often doesn’t hurt at first. It might bleed, feel firm, or slowly grow. Don’t wait more than 2-3 weeks if something isn’t healing or feels off. How Mouth Cancer is diagnosed If your dentist or doctor sees something suspicious, they’ll usually start with a simple visual exam. They’ll check the inside of your cheeks, under your tongue, and along your gums. If they find something, the next step is usually a biopsy, where a small bit of tissue is taken and sent to a lab. That’s the only way to know for sure if it’s cancer. Other tests like CT scans, MRI, or even X-rays might be used to check if it’s spread to the jaw or neck. Different types of Mouth Cancer There’s not just one kind of mouth cancer—there are several types, and some are more aggressive than others. Squamous cell carcinoma is the most common. It starts in the thin, flat cells lining the mouth. Verrucous carcinoma is slower-growing but still needs treatment. It can show up in people who chew tobacco. Minor salivary gland cancer happens deeper in the mouth—on the roof or back of the throat. Other rare types include melanomas, lymphomas, and sarcomas, which form in connective tissue. The type of cancer helps guide which treatment plan is best. Treatment options for Mouth Cancer Treatment depends on where the cancer is and how far it’s spread. Some people only need surgery. What is liver cancer, and how does it develop Liver cancer starts when cells inside the liver begin growing the wrong way. Instead of dying like they should, they keep multiplying, and after a while, they form a tumor. Some of these tumors stay small, but others grow fast or spread to other parts of the body. That’s when things get serious. There’s primary liver cancer, which starts in the liver itself. The most common kind is h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Then there’s secondary liver cancer or metastatic liver cancer, which spreads to the liver from somewhere else—like the colon, breast, or lungs. The liver does a lot, from filtering your blood to digesting food. That’s why when something goes wrong here, it affects the whole body. Main causes and risk factors of liver cancer Most people who get liver cancer already had some kind of liver damage before. One of the top causes is hepatitis B or C—those viruses hurt the liver over time, and sometimes that damage turns into cancer. But anyone with a messed-up liver is at risk. Different types of liver cancer There’s more than one type. The main one is h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C)—starts in liver cells, most common. Then you’ve got cholangiocarcinoma, which starts in the bile ducts. Some call it bile duct cancer. Not as common, but harder to treat. Angiosarcoma and hemangiosarcoma start in the blood vessels in the liver—these are rare and aggressive. If the liver cancer came from another part of the body, it’s not technically “liver cancer,” it’s called metastatic liver cancer. But it’s treated seriously either way. Each one acts different, and doctors need to know what they’re dealing with to choose the right plan. How liver cancer is diagnosed If a doctor suspects something, they’ll start with blood tests. One key marker is AFP (alpha-fetoprotein)—if it’s high, that’s a red flag. Next up are scans—ultrasound, CT, or MRI to look inside the liver. These help show if there’s a mass, how big it is, and if it’s spread. Sometimes, they’ll need a liver biopsy, where they take a tiny piece of liver and look at it under a microscope. Once they’ve got all that, they figure out the liver cancer stages and start planning treatment. Stages of liver cancer and what they mean There are four main stages. Stage 1 liver cancer means the tumor is still small and hasn’t spread.Stage 2 might be one big tumor or a few small ones, maybe starting to mess with blood vessels.Stage 3 liver cancer means it’s growing into nearby areas or veins, and maybe starting to spread inside the liver.Stage 4 liver cancer is when it’s spread to other parts of the body—lungs, bones, lymph nodes. Treatment options for liver cancer Treatment depends on where you’re at. If they catch it early, surgery might be able to remove the tumor. Some people get a liver transplant, especially if their liver is already damaged from cirrhosis or hepatitis. Other treatments include:– Radiofrequency ablation (burns the tumor with heat)– Chemo (less common, but still used in some cases)– Targeted therapy (goes after cancer cells without killing everything else)– Immunotherapy, which helps the body fight back naturally There’s no single answer. Doctors pick based on size, location, type, and overall health. What bladder cancer is and how it starts Bladder cancer begins when some cells inside the bladder lining stop behaving how they should. Instead of dying off like normal, they keep growing and piling up, eventually turning into a tumor. Sometimes it stays in the lining, but other times it grows deeper into the bladder wall, and if it keeps spreading, it can reach nearby organs too. It mostly shows up in older people, especially men over 55, but it’s not just a man’s disease. Women can get it too. Some cases grow slow, others more aggressive. That’s why early detection makes all the difference. First signs people usually notice Most people first notice blood in the urine. It can look bright red or just a faint pink—you might not even spot it unless you’re really looking. Some feel burning while peeing, or feel like they need to go more than usual. Others feel like they can’t fully empty their bladder. Sometimes it feels just like a urinary infection, which is why it gets missed at first. But if these things keep happening, it’s worth checking, even if they don’t seem that bad. What causes bladder cancer or makes it more likely Smoking is the biggest reason. The chemicals from cigarettes pass through the kidneys, and get stored in the bladder. Over time, they damage the lining and raise your risk big time. Straining to pee, blood, acting restless. How doctors figure out what’s going on It usually starts with a urine test, just to check for blood or weird-looking cells. If anything looks off, the next step is a cystoscopy—a tiny camera is used to look inside the bladder. If they see anything that doesn’t look right, they’ll take a biopsy. That means they remove a little bit of tissue to send to the lab. Imaging like CT scans helps show if it’s spread outside the bladder. All this helps figure out your bladder cancer stage, which tells how far it’s gone and what the next steps are. Bladder Cancer in men Bladder Cancer in Women   Different types and how serious they can be The most common type is called urothelial carcinoma. That starts in the inner lining of the bladder. Sometimes it stays there, other times it breaks through into the muscle and beyond. When it’s just on the surface, it’s easier to treat. If it’s spread into the muscle, it’s more serious. There’s also advanced bladder cancer, which means it’s moved to other organs or bones. That’s usually stage 4 bladder cancer and it needs stronger treatment. Treatment options and what to expect If it’s early, a doctor might be able to remove the tumor through a small scope—no major surgery needed. But in some cases, part or even all of the bladder has to be taken out. That’s where bladder cancer surgery comes in. There’s also: Chemotherapy Radiation Immunotherapy, especially for early-stage cancers One popular method is BCG treatment for bladder cancer, where a special liquid is put right into the bladder to trigger the immune system. This is called BCG bladder cancer therapy and it works well for some patients Every case is different, and so are side effects. Even stress might have something to do with it, though doctors are still studying that. Not everything has a clear answer yet. How Doctors Diagnose Breast Cancer It usually starts with a mammogram. That’s a low-dose X-ray of the breast. If they see something odd, they may do an ultrasound or MRI to get a closer look. If it still looks like something’s wrong, the next step is a biopsy. That means taking a small bit of tissue and checking it under a microscope. If there’s cancer, they’ll figure out what kind. Catching it early—like at stage 0 breast cancer—makes a big difference. That’s when it hasn’t spread beyond where it started. Treatment at that point is often more simple. The Different Types of Breast Cancer Not all breast cancers are the same. Some stay in place, others spread fast. Non-invasive cancers stay where they started. Invasive cancers move into the breast tissue. HER2 positive breast cancer means the cancer cells have extra HER2 protein. Triple positive breast cancer is positive for HER2, estrogen, and progesterone—good thing is, it can be treated in a few ways. Then there’s triple-negative, which doesn’t have any of those markers. It’s harder to treat and often more aggressive. Knowing the type matters. It changes the treatment plan and how fast doctors need to act. Tamoxifen (Caditam), a selective estrogen receptor modulator (SERM), has dramatically improved survival effects for patients with estrogen receptor-positive (ER+) breast cancer. However, its dualistic nature—performing as an estrogen antagonist in breast tissue and an agonist in the uterus—increases legitimate issues regarding endometrial health. While the hazard is real, the solution lies in nuanced variables, including dosage, duration, age, and an individual's predisposition. Tamoxifen’s Mechanism and Uterine Tissue Sensitivity Tamoxifen selectively blocks estrogen receptors in breast tissue, inhibiting the proliferative effects of estrogen in malignancies. Paradoxically, within the endometrium (the uterine lining), it mimics estrogen, promoting cellular growth. This agonist pastime will increase the risk of hyperplasia, polyps, and, in uncommon instances, uterine cancer, particularly endometrial carcinoma.This tissue-particular hobby is central to understanding how tamoxifen, while life-saving, might also concurrently increase gynecologic risk over time. How Quickly Can Tamoxifen Cause Uterine Cancer? Studies display that uterine cancer associated with tamoxifen use typically develops after 2 to 5 years of continuous use. The risk rises progressively after the 2-year mark, mainly in postmenopausal women, and peaks after 5 years of use.Higher cumulative tamoxifen dosage and extended exposure increase this danger. While the absolute hazard stays low, vigilance is paramount in long-term users. Recognizing the Early Signs of Endometrial Changes Monitoring for early signs can substantially reduce the chance of cancer development. Warning signs and symptoms include:🔹 Abnormal vaginal bleeding or discharge🔹 Pelvic ache or pressure🔹 Postmenopausal bleedingRoutine pelvic checks, transvaginal ultrasounds, and endometrial biopsies are advocated in the course of prolonged tamoxifen therapy to detect abnormalities at an early, treatable stage. Long-Term Use and Endometrial Risk: A 5-Year Turning Point The side effects of tamoxifen after 5 years are more commonly reported and clinically significant. While the first few years provide the most healing benefits with a relatively low risk of endometrial complications, the probability of uterine complications increases thereafter.As a result, many oncologists examine risk-advantage ratios at the 5-12 months threshold, especially for postmenopausal women, and may recollect transitioning patients to tamoxifen alternatives like aromatase inhibitors while suitable. The time it takes for thyroid cancer to be detected depends on several factors, such as its kind, increase rate, and whether it causes major signs and symptoms. Some types of thyroid cancers are sluggish-developing, which means they are able to stay undetected for years, even as others progress more quickly.Here’s a breakdown of how lengthy distinct sorts of thyroid most cancers can move not noted: 1. Papillary Thyroid Cancer (Most Common – 80-85% of Cases) 🔹 Growth Rate: Very gradual🔹 Undetected for 25 years🔹 Symptoms: Often asymptomatic; can be discovered by accident all through imaging checks for different conditions🔹 Spread: Spreads to close-by lymph nodes but stays treatablePapillary thyroid cancers can exist for many years without displaying symptoms. Many instances are located by means of a twist of fate while patients go through thyroid ultrasounds, CT scans, or MRIs for unrelated health concerns. 2. Follicular Thyroid Cancer (10-15% of Cases) 🔹 Growth Rate: Slow to mild🔹 Undetected for Several years🔹 Symptoms: May purpose a lump in the neck, problem swallowing, or voice changes over time🔹 Spread: Can spread to the lungs or bones earlier than being identifiedFollicular thyroid cancer is often detected later than papillary thyroid cancer because it does not typically unfold to lymph nodes early on. Instead, it spreads through the bloodstream to distant organs. 3. Medullary Thyroid Cancer (3-four% of Cases) 🔹 Growth Rate: Moderate🔹 Undetected for Months to a few years🔹 Symptoms: Neck lump, diarrhea, flushing, or hormonal imbalances🔹 Spread: Can unfold to distant organs early in the diseaseMedullary thyroid cancer (MTC) isn't the same as other types as it originates from C-cells, which produce calcitonin, a hormone that regulates calcium stages. Some cases of MTC are genetic, which means human beings may be unaware they convey the risk until signs and symptoms appear. 4. Anaplastic Thyroid Cancer (Rare and Aggressive – Less than 1% of Cases) 🔹 Growth Rate: Extremely speedy🔹 Undetected for Weeks to months🔹 Symptoms: Rapidly growing neck mass, problem respiration, hoarseness, pain🔹 Spread: Quickly spreads to the lungs, bones, and different organsAnaplastic thyroid, most cancers, is one of the most aggressive forms and does no longer continue to be undiagnosed for lengthy. It progresses unexpectedly, inflicting extreme signs and symptoms within a brief length. Early detection is crucial for improving consequences. Blood stress, characteristic of the live,r and regular trace of potassium levels is important for protection.   Common Side Effects and Management Strategies of Abiraterone Therapy Abiraterone acetate, used in met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C), is usually nicely tolerated but can cause tremendous aspect effects due to CYP17 inhibition and associated hormonal adjustments. Key destructive outcomes and their control techniques encompass: Hypertension: Results from excess mineralocorticoid pastime. Managed with antihypertensive medicines (e.g., ACE inhibitors, calcium channel blockers) and sodium restriction. Hypokalemia: Due to accelerated aldosterone degrees. Managed with potassium supplementation and mineralocorticoid receptor antagonists (e.g., spironolactone, eplerenone). Fluid Retention & Edema: Results from sodium and water retention. Controlled by way of diuretics and tracking fluid consumption. Hepatotoxicity: Elevated liver enzymes (ALT, AST) require normal liver feature tests (LFTs). Dose adjustments or temporary discontinuation can be essential. Fatigue & Weakness: Managed through way of life changes, physical activity, and dietary guide. Adrenal Insufficiency: This can occur due to suppression of ACTH. Low-dose prednisone facilitates mitigating this danger. Regular tracking of blood pressure, electrolytes, and liver function is vital to optimize treatment protection and efficacy.   Monitoring Liver Function During Abiraterone Therapy Abiraterone acetate, used in met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ancers (mCRPC), can cause hepatotoxicity, requiring cautious liver function tracking. Since Abiraterone undergoes hepatic metabolism through CYP3A4, it can result in accelerated alanine aminotransferase (ALT) and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) ranges, doubtlessly resulting in liver harm. Monitoring Guidelines: Baseline Liver Function Tests (LFTs): Before beginning treatment, determine ALT, AST, general bilirubin, and alkaline phosphatase. Frequent Monitoring: Every 2 weeks for the primary 3 months. Monthly thereafter, or more frequently if abnormalities arise. Signs of Hepatotoxicity: Patients must be discovered with jaundice, fatigue, darkish urine, nausea, or proper top quadrant ache. Management of Abnormal LFTs: Mild Elevation (AST/ALT <5× ULN): Continue therapy with close monitoring. Moderate Elevation (AST/ALT 5–20× ULN): Interrupt treatment until levels normalize; consider dose reduction. Severe Elevation (AST/ALT >20× ULN or bilirubin >three× ULN): Discontinue abiraterone permanently. Liver characteristic tracking is essential to making sure remedy protection and lengthy-time period affected person consequences.   Drug Interactions: What to Avoid While on Abiraterone Abiraterone acetate, metabolized by CYP3A4, can have widespread drug interactions that may adjust its efficacy and protection. Patients need to keep away from the following: CYP3A4 Inducers (Reduce Abiraterone Levels, Decreasing Efficacy) Examples: Rifampin, Carbamazepine, Phenytoin, St. John’s Wort Recommendation: Avoid or use alternative medicines; dose adjustment can be necessary. CYP3A4 Inhibitors (Increase Abiraterone Levels, Raising Toxicity Risk) Examples: Ketoconazole, Itraconazole, Clarithromycin, Ritonavir Recommendation: Monitor for toxicity (hypertension, hepatotoxicity) and adjust the abiraterone dose if needed. Drugs Affecting Potassium Levels (Increased Risk of Hypokalemia) Examples: Loop diuretics (furosemide), Thiazides, Digoxin Recommendation: Monitor potassium ranges frequently and complement if wished. Medications that Increase Cardiovascular Risk Examples: NSAIDs (ibuprofen, naproxen), Steroids in excessive doses Recommendation: Use carefully to keep away from fluid retention, high blood pressure, and cardiovascular complications. Strong P-Glycoprotein (P-gp) Substrates Examples: Dabigatran, Digoxin Recommendation: Monitor for altered drug outcomes, as abiraterone can impact their metabolism. These ongoing advancements are refining abiraterone's function in prostate cancer treatment, making therapy more powerful, available, and personalized for patients.   Patient Considerations: Who Should and Shouldn’t Use Abiraterone Who Should Use Abiraterone? Abiraterone acetate is usually recommended for patients with: Metastatic Castration-Resistant Prostate Cancer (mCRPC): Approved for men whose most cancers progress despite androgen deprivation therapy (ADT). Metastatic Hormone-Sensitive Prostate Cancer (mHSPC): Often utilized in combination with ADT to improve survival. High-Risk or Advanced Disease: Patients with excessive tumor burden gain from early abiraterone use. Good Liver and Cardiovascular Health: Those without severe liver disease or out-of-control coronary heart situations tolerate abiraterone higher. Who Shouldn’t Use Abiraterone? Severe Liver Dysfunction: Patients with Child-Pugh Class C liver disorder need to avoid abiraterone due to excessive hepatotoxicity hazard. Uncontrolled Hypertension: Since abiraterone will increase mineralocorticoid activity, it could get worse excessive blood pressure. Severe Heart Conditions: Patients with current coronary heart attacks, excessive coronary heart failure, or arrhythmias are at better hazard of fluid retention and cardiovascular activities. CYP3A4 Drug Interaction Risks: Those on sturdy CYP3A4 inhibitors or inducers want cautious tracking or opportunity cures. Pregnant or Childbearing Women: Although rare in practice, abiraterone is exactly contraindicated in women because of fetal damage risks. Key Considerations Baseline and Regular Monitoring: Liver features, potassium ranges, and blood stress have to be checked often. Use with Prednisone: Helps counteract mineralocorticoid excess consequences like hypertension and hypokalemia. Cost and Accessibility: Abiraterone can be steeply priced; monetary help applications may be wished for a few sufferers. The Role of Androgens in Prostate Cancer Prostate cancer cells depend upon androgens (together with testosterone and dihydrotestosterone) to develop and spread. While androgen deprivation remedy (ADT), also referred to as hormonal remedy, goals to reduce testosterone ranges, the frame nonetheless produces small quantities of androgens through: The adrenal glands Cancer cells themselves Even after surgical or scientific castration (elimination of testicular testosterone manufacturing), prostate cancer cells can also nonetheless gather the androgenic stimulation they need to proliferate.
